Scaffolding Awareness Course
Standards
OSHA Standard: 1926.95, .451, .454, .503, Subpart L
Scaffolding Awareness Course outlines the basic information and hazards associated with scaffolding. It identifies the various different reasons that a fall from scaffolds occurs.
Additional topics cover the role of the competent person, what unsafe structures look like, and how to identify when their own safety is at risk on raised platforms. The learner will explore different control methods for falling objects, electrical systems, and collapse hazards.
